Washington Nationals announce mini plans for 2015 season
Beginning today, Washington Nationals fans will have the opportunity to choose between four exciting mini ticket plans to catch some of the hottest games of the 2015 season. This year's Mini Plans include:
- Manager of the Year Plan (15 games): Celebrate Manager Matt Williams' 2014 Manager of the Year Award by signing up for this unique plan. This offer is comprised of 15 matchups including games against the Cardinals, Blue Jays, Padres and Pirates, among many others. This plan offers the most games of any mini plan detailed below.
- Sunday Plan (13 games): Never miss a Sunday at Nationals Park! Bring your young rookies to the ballpark for Signature Sundays and postgame Kids Run the Bases all season long. This family-friendly plan includes the final home game of the year as well as crucial matchups against the Giants, Dodgers and Braves, among others.
- 10-Year Tuesday Plan (10 games): Join the Nats in celebrating the team's 10-Year Anniversary by enjoying all six 10-Year Tuesday games. Occurring one Tuesday each month, these designated 10-Year Tuesdays will feature special guests, pregame ceremonies and a collectible keepsake for the first 10,000 fans to enter Nationals Park each night. This plan also includes three games against the Phillies, Rays and Brewers, plus a crucial matchup against the Orioles.
- Rendon Garden Gnome Plan (10 games): Watch Anthony Rendon and the Nats take on top opponents, including the night of Rendon's garden gnome giveaway on August 25. The plan also includes the exhibition game against the New York Yankees plus visits from the Orioles, Cardinals and Cubs.
